Abstract
We present preliminary results for the determination of the leading strange and charm quark-connected contributions to the hadronic vacuum polarization contribution to the muon's g - 2. Measurements are performed on the RC* collaboration's QCD ensembles, with 3 + 1 flavors of O(a) improved Wilson fermions and C* boundary conditions. The HVP is computed on a single value of the lattice spacing and two lattice volumes at unphysical pion mass. In addition, we compare the signal-to-noise ratio for different lattice discretizations of the vector current.
